Body shops change these daily. For any who have bought a used G, there is a chance that yours has been replaced. If installed correctly, there is no difference from the factory. They screw them in place at the factory also, they don't appear by magic. Just go to a reputable body shop and get them to help. Many will tell you the best place to get a replacement in your area. They can replace it in just a few minutes. It is not a big deal and it is not unsafe.
